About Claire

My name is Claire and I am a second year doctoral student at the University of Alberta's School of Public Health. I am eager to help students navigate undergrad- and graduate-level problems. Specifically, I can help with scientific writing and communication, biostatistics, epidemiology, and other topics related to public health.

  • 1. When and why did you develop an interest in your chosen field?

    I developed an interest in Epidemiology in the third year of my undergraduate degree when I took my introductory Epidemiology course. It sparked an interest because of the breadth of topics you could study under epidemiology.
  • 2. What makes you passionate about your subject?

    I love the empirical and systematic nature of epidemiology. I also enjoy the wide variety of methods employed in the field and the ability to study a wide variety of topics. My current research interests are in social inequities and their impact on mental health, something I am very passionate about.
  • 3. What do you like about tutoring? What makes you a "Superprof"?

    I love learning about the projects students have going on and being able to help. During my MSc degree, I used Superprof to improve my writing skills and really enjoyed the process. My tutor was incredibly helpful and the process was so easy!
  • 4. Do you have any role models; a teacher that inspired you?

    All of my instructors have been inspirational to me. I truly enjoy school -- which is my I'm still in it!
  • 5. What are your keys to success?

    Examples, examples, examples! I love to draw upon current events and my own personal experiences to describe epidemiological questions.
